Purpose
The purpose of ‘Fi’s Butterfly Effect’ gofundme is to raise money for families who have a family member undergoing palliative care (near the end of life). Fi Hansen was the definition of kindness and we want to share that with others.
 
Jesse aims to start a charity this year in the same name, to enable families to spend precious time together, making memories.
 
The idea of the charity was shaped through the experience of Dave, Jordie and Jesse Hansen. Fi Hansen was the beloved step-mum to Jordie and Jesse and wife to Dave. Fi was diagnosed with ampullary cancer in November 2019 and passed away in August 2021.  Through the generosity of friends and family they were able to share the last two years of her life enjoying precious time together and creating memories. When Covid restrictions allowed they holidayed together and Fi was able to spend her final days in her favourite location of all, Mount Martha where she holidayed with her family throughout her life.
 
It was during Jordie and Jesse’s time on Survivor when they realised how fortunate they were to have been able to spend that precious time with Fi. As a result, the idea to start a charity to support families in a similar situation was born. Particularly as they felt many families wouldn’t have the financial support of friends and family that they had received.
 
The name ‘Fi’s Butterfly Effect’ and the logo of a butterfly holds significant importance to Jordie and Jesse. Fi absolutely loved butterflies and in a final letter she wrote to Jordie and Jesse for them to read after her passing she referenced that every time they saw a butterfly they were to think ‘be thankful and what can I do today to make someone else’s life better?’ During the filming of Survivor the boys were blown away by the number of butterflies that surrounded their camps and this really helped them to feel a strong connection with Fi during their time in the game. It was also during their time in the game in which the idea of starting their own charity really came to light. Hence, the butterfly holds significant importance to the boys and their connection to Fi and their connection to Survivor in which the idea was born. Butterfly Effect also gives reference to the idea that the tiniest acts of kindness can have a significant impact on someone’s life. Fi’s words to live by, “being kind, being thankful” could live on in a charity named after her.
